# Java Client - Spring Security Rest for Grails

Java library to interact with [Spring Security Rest for Grails](http://alvarosanchez.github.io/grails-spring-security-rest/latest/docs/) plugin.

It uses the [JSON Web Token (JWT)](http://alvarosanchez.github.io/grails-spring-security-rest/latest/docs/#_json_web_token) capabilities offered by plugin.

## Installation

```grovoy
repositories {
jcenter()
}

dependencies {
compile 'org.grails:java-client-grails-spring-security-rest:0.3'
}
```

## Login

[Authentication Request](http://alvarosanchez.github.io/grails-spring-security-rest/latest/docs/#_authentication_endpoint):

```java
String serverUrl = "http://localhost:8080";
String username = "sherlock";
String password = "elementary";
def authenticationRequest = new AuthenticationRequest.Builder()
.serverUrl(serverUrl)
.username(username)
.password(password)
.build();
JwtResponse rsp = client.authenticate(authenticationRequest);
```

### Correct Credentials

If authentication is successful a _JwtResponseOK_ object is returned. This object
contains a Jwt property.

```java
public interface Jwt {
String getUsername();

List getRoles();

String getTokenType();

String getAccessToken();

int getExpiresIn();

String getRefreshToken();
}
```

### Incorrect Credentials

If the credentials are incorrect a _JwtResponseUnauthorized_ object is returned.

## Token Refresh

To refresh the credentials issue this request:

```java

## Dependencies

The library uses internally [OkHttp](http://square.github.io/okhttp/) and [Gson](https://github.com/google/gson)
